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2019-06-26 Ch. SL 2019-53 became-law
  • 2019-06-26 Signed by Gov. 6/26/2019 executive-signature
  • 2019-06-21 Pres. To Gov. 6/21/2019 executive-receipt
  • 2019-06-20 Ratified
  • 2019-06-19 Ordered Enrolled
  • 2019-06-19 Concurred In S Com Sub amendment-passage
  • 2019-06-17 Placed On Cal For 06/19/2019
  • 2019-06-17 Cal Pursuant 36(b)
  • 2019-06-14 Regular Message Received For Concurrence in S Com Sub
  • 2019-06-14 Regular Message Sent To House
  • 2019-06-13 Passed 3rd Reading passage, reading-3
  • 2019-06-13 Passed 2nd Reading reading-2
  • 2019-06-12 Placed On Cal For 06/13/2019
  • 2019-06-12 Withdrawn From Cal
  • 2019-06-11 Reptd Fav committee-passage-favorable
  • 2019-06-05 Re-ref Com On Rules and Operations of the Senate referral-committee
  • 2019-06-05 Com Substitute Adopted
  • 2019-06-05 Reptd Fav Com Substitute committee-passage-favorable
  • 2019-05-24 Re-ref to Judiciary. If fav, re-ref to Rules and Operations of the Senate referral-committee
  • 2019-05-24 Withdrawn From Com
  • 2019-04-17 Ref To Com On Rules and Operations of the Senate referral-committee
  • 2019-04-17 Passed 1st Reading reading-1
  • 2019-04-17 Regular Message Received From House
  • 2019-04-17 Regular Message Sent To Senate
  • 2019-04-16 Passed 3rd Reading passage, reading-3
  • 2019-04-16 Passed 2nd Reading reading-2
  • 2019-04-15 Placed On Cal For 04/16/2019
  • 2019-04-15 Cal Pursuant Rule 36(b)
  • 2019-04-15 Reptd Fav committee-passage-favorable
  • 2019-04-10 Re-ref Com On Rules, Calendar, and Operations of the House referral-committee
  • 2019-04-10 Reptd Fav committee-passage-favorable
  • 2019-04-02 Ref to the Com on Judiciary, if favorable, Rules, Calendar, and Operations of the House referral-committee
  • 2019-04-02 Passed 1st Reading reading-1
  • 2019-04-01 Filed introduction
